About this map

Dickey County Waterfowl Production Area dominates this section of the Great Plains, where a complex network of wetlands and prairie potholes defines the landscape. The small settlement of Wirch stands as a focal point for local history, supported by nearby sites like the Wirch Cem and Spring Valley Cem that offer important touchpoints for genealogical research. The terrain is characterized by numerous water bodies including Wood Lake, Crow Lake, and Happy Lake, while the seasonal drainage of Webber Gulch cuts through the southeastern corner. This modern survey illustrates the enduring section-line road grid, featuring routes from 90th St SE to 96th St SE, which continue to facilitate access through these protected conservation lands and agricultural reaches of Dickey County.
